Hawaii's Public Beaches: A Comprehensive Access Guide

Hawaii's picturesque shorelines provide a remarkable opportunity for recreation , and knowing public beach access is crucial for all visitors . This handbook details current regulations regarding coastal usage, covering everything from vehicle placement and restroom facilities to sanctioned activities and any conceivable restrictions. While nearly all beaches are available to the public, specific areas may have restricted access due to personal property or conservation concerns. Remember to check state signage and refer to the state agency website for the current information before your journey.

Exploring California's Public Beach Access Rights

California’s distinct coastline boasts a intricate system regarding open beach admittance rights. Traditionally , understandings of these rights have evolved , leading to continuous legal disputes . The Coastal Act , a landmark piece of legislation , established a strong pledge to safeguarding shared opportunity to the shoreline . However , hurdles remain, such as private holdings blocking easy paths to the sea. Familiarizing yourself with these judicial structures is vital for experiencing California’s beautiful beaches.
